Kalshi AL Cy Young trading preview
Yankees pitcher Cam Schlittler struggled in his first start in August, allowing four hits and four earned runs in just 3.0 innings of work against the Cardinals on Aug. 3. However, he bounced back with a productive performance on Aug. 9 against the Braves, giving up just three hits and one earned run across 7.0 innings.
Meanwhile, Blue Jays pitcher Dylan Cease has been spectacular since coming off a hamstring injury earlier this season. On July 25, Cease allowed just one hit and three walks while striking out 12 in a complete-game shutout against the Red Sox. He also pitched seven scoreless innings while recording 10 strikeouts in his outing against the Cubs on Aug. 6.
